DKSH delivers good profitable growth in H1 2021
Growth rates H1 2021 vs H1 2020 (at CER)
- Net sales +5.3%
- EBIT +20.7%
- EBIT margin 2.4% (+30 bp)
- Profit after tax +47.7%
- Free Cash Flow +109.8%
- RONOC 18.7% (+350 bp)
